Ballaghaue Burial Mound

Archaeology

A ditchless, grass-covered bowl barrow with a rather pointed top. It has a diameter of 14.0 metres and a height of 1.8 metres. Set in its lower slopes on the southeast side is an upright stone slab which is apparently modern and is drilled with 3 holes, measuring 0.8 metres high by 0.5 metres by 0.1 metre.


John Wesley is said to have preached from this mound.
